directions

  • PREHEAT oven to 400°F
  • Place chicken and potatoes in 13x9-inch baking dish.
  • POUR dressing over chicken and potatoes; sprinkle with cheese.
  • BAKE 1 hour or until chicken is cooked through (180ºF).
  • Sprinkle with chopped fresh parsley, if desired.
